There are many different Linux distributions (sometimes called distros). While it would be easier for the purposes of this class to chose one and give instructions accordingly, we will not do that for two reasons:
Thus we will show how things work on the following distribution families :
- We want you to understand what is globally true for all Linux systems and what is only true for a given family of distributions.
- The Linux Foundation does not endorse or promote any one particular distribution since we support the community as a whole.
- Fedora: Including Fedora, Red Hat Enterprise Linux (RHEL), and CentOS.
- Debian: Including Debian, Ubuntu and Mint.
- SUSE: Including SUSE, and OpenSUSE.
